Extracting Gold | HowStuffWorks

Removing the gold-bearing rock from the ground is just the first step. To isolate pure gold, mining companies use a complex extraction process. The first step in this process is breaking down large chunks of rock into smaller pieces. At a mill, large machines known as crushers reduce the ore to pieces no larger than road gravel.

Gold Recovery 101 - Sepro Mineral Systems

A refractory gold ore can be defined as any ore that responds poorly to a conventional gravity- cyanidation process with examples often including copper porphyry, complex sulfides, arsenopyrite and lead-zinc associations.

The process mineralogy of gold: The classification of ore ...

The principal gold minerals that affect the processing of gold ores are native gold, electrum, Au-Ag tellurides, aurostibite, maldonite, and auricupride. In addition, submicroscopic (solid solution) gold, principally in arsenopyrite and pyrite, is also important. The main causes of refractory gold ores are submicroscopic gold, the Au-Ag tellurides, and very fine-grained gold (<10 µm) locked ...

Production of Gold

Unit 100 – Size Reduction of Ore The BFD of the overall process is shown in Figure 1. The PFD for Unit 100, shown in Figure 2, is designed to reduce 41.5 tons/hr of gold ore from a feed range of 2-5" to 160 microns. The mined ore is fed using a Grizzly Feeder, F-101, into a Jaw Crusher, J-101, where 80% of the ore is crushed to 1.75" or ...
